Public health sector specialist
Our prescription printers are not only
built in our own factories but are accredited to EMIS, iSoft and InPS,
so you can depend on their quality and reliability. This gives assurance
that the equipment you choose is robust enough for the high-pressured
healthcare environment.
Some of our printers can be connected over your practice network to
allow streamlined working. You can manage the network remotely from
anywhere in the practice, so a document can be sent from the office
to a consulting room or a consulting room to a dispensary. |
Multi function
Look out for printers that multi-task – essential in
today's busy health environment. For some practices, this means a
machine that scans as well as prints, which could be useful if you're
moving to a paper-light practice and want to attach documents to electronic
records.
But in the health sector, the most important double function you need
is the ability to print prescriptions as well as standard documents.
Choose one of Samsung's compact models that can sit on desktops and
save space in busy consulting rooms, and machines capable of switching
between paper sizes automatically so that even the most tech-fearful
staff member can make full use of them.

Other important features:
Value: Samsung's
printers give you, on average, better value per page than any other
leading brand.
Paper saving:
many of our printers have automatic duplex printing, which saves you
paper by allowing you to print double sided without removing and flipping
paper.
Running costs: features like
the Toner Save button on the ML-3051N may cut running costs
by up to 40%.
Security:
for some networked printers look for extra security functions such
as pin codes or swipe cards to protect patient data.
